Using the HDMI CONTROL Function for 'BRAVIA' Theatre Sync Enjoying the TV Sound from the Speakers in this System (System Audio Control) You can enjoy the TV sound from the speakers of this system by a simple operation. To use System Audio Control, connect the control unit and the TV with an audio cord (not supplied) (A) and an HDMI cable (not supplied) (B). : Audio signal flow TV A AUDIO OUT L R IN IN DMPORT B Rear of the control unit Depending on the TV setting, the system turns on and switches to "TV" function automatically while you are watching the TV. TV sound is output from the system speakers, and the volume of the TV speakers is minimized simultaneously. You can use System Audio Control as follows: • When you turn on this system while watching the TV, TV sound is output from the system speakers automatically. • You can adjust the system volume using the TV volume. • If you turn off the system, the sound will be output from the TV speakers. You can also operate System Audio Control from the TV menu. For details, see the operating instructions of the TV. Note • When the TV is turned on before turning on the system, the TV sound will not output for a moment. • When you select the TV program (the active picture is highlighted) or return to the TV mode while watching the TV and a DVD by PAP (picture and picture) mode, the DVD playback will stop. • To output the sound from the TV, set [AUDIO (HDMI)] to [ON] on the system (page 92). 44US
